University of Arizona is seeking a Coordinator, Administrative Operations to provide comprehensive administrative support for Enrollment Management. The role serves as a front-facing representative, coordinates calendars and travel, handles purchasing, and assists with recruitment and student employee activities.
Responsibilities include managing communications, supporting events, and maintaining organized office operations.
The Coordinator, Administrative Operations role provides comprehensive administrative and operational support for the Enrollment Management division, ensuring efficient day-to-day operations and exceptional customer service for internal and external stakeholders. This position coordinates scheduling, communications, travel, purchasing, logistics, and office support while serving as a primary front-facing representative for Enrollment Management. The role also supports recruitment initiatives, student employee coordination, and special projects, contributing to the successful execution of the division's strategic priorities.

In compliance with the Jeanne Clery Campus Safety Act (Clery Act), each year the University of Arizona releases an Annual Security Report (ASR) for each of the University's campuses.Thesereports disclose information including Clery crime statistics for the previous three calendar years and policies, procedures, and programs the University uses to keep students and employees safe, including how to report crimes or other emergencies and resources for crime victims. As a campus with residential housing facilities, the Main Campus ASR also includes a combined Annual Fire Safety report with information on fire statistics and fire safety systems, policies, and procedures.
